Despite of multiple attempts to improve treatment in recent decades, none strategies has improved prognosis in locally advanced stage III and IV GC. A therapeutic approach to GC based on current histological and image criteria (Tumour Node Metastasis -TNM- stage) is insufficient. Although multiple targeted agents are currently under investigation, so far, only trastuzumab and ramucirumab have demonstrated efficacy in advanced GC and have a regulatory approval. For this reason, the identification of specific targets that could be susceptible for drug inhibition, is an urgent requirement. Moreover, most studies and current international databases on late-stage/advanced GC are largely based on Asian populations, in sharp contrast tumour biology and genome of EU or CELAC populations remain poorly known.
